A 3.5-kg block of iron (c=0.11 kcal/kgoC) that has been brought to a temperature of 1,063oC is placed on top of a 2.5-kg block of ice (c=0.5 kcal/kgoC) that has been cooled to -50oC. Assuming no heat is lost to the surrounding container, what is the final temperature of the iron block? (Your answer should be given to the nearest oC.)
